Have you ever seen a business that was called a Small Business when you thought it was more on the big business side? Well, in the US the "Small Business Administration" decides what makes a business a Small Business. This is on an industry-by-industry basis as well as sales assets on net profits and the number of employees. So a Small Business is a business that has less than 500 employees and less than $7 million in annual receipts.
That sounds like a Big Business when it comes to other countries like Austrailia who says a Small Business has less than 15 employees and in the European Union 50 employees are less. So you want to start a Small Business?
